SkillOnNet to make US debut

PlayOJO will now have access to players in New Jersey through a market access agreement with Caesars Entertainment

SkillOnNet, the platform provider behind some of the biggest online casino brands in the world, will make its greatly anticipated US market debut in New Jersey after completing a market access deal with Caesars Entertainment pending regulatory approval.

The deal will allow SkillOnNet to launch its PlayOJO brand on its own proprietary software to players in the Garden State where it plans to disrupt the market with its fully transparent, fair approach. This deal comes after its success in the main European markets where it is among the top players in its category in many regulated jurisdictions.

SkillOnNet will establish a strong local HQ operation in the US with marketing, product development and technology teams also focusing on securing additional market access partnerships and iGaming and media deals across the country.

Maor Nutkevitch - SkillOnNetMaor Nutkevitch, Head of Corporate Development at SkillOnNet said: “This is a milestone opportunity for SkillOnNet. We have seen the immense growth in New Jersey and very successful iGaming launches in other US states. PlayOJO offers an unrivalled gaming experience with a huge game portfolio and focus on safe and fair gambling. We are confident that launching this casino focused challenger brand at this stage of the market evolution, will allow us to build a meaningful market share within few years of operation.’’
